July 17, 201311 yr pair 1 i think its violet DF dominant pied as it is purplish or could be mauve with normal green MAUVE dom pied to green normal....................green is dominant .............expect green normals and green pieds ............unless the green is split blue The green has scalyface so I wouldnt be breeding him at all till hes well and sorted out Pair 2 i think they are both Light green DF dominant pieds They are dark green not light green .........DF to Df dom pieds if they are df will give you df dom pieds Pair 3 i think its light green opaline spangle with blue/grey opaline spangle opaline spangles in green unless the green is split blue ......you have a 25% chance of a double factor spangle BUT the male looks sick so I would breed him at all if I was you As for colours pair 1, could be green normals and Opalines. where do you get that from ?
